Indiana Posted November 27, 2011 Report Share Posted November 27, 2011 LEDs have such little load they can't cause a relay to cycle so you need a relay for LEDs or you can put a resister in the line to simulate a buld and keep the old flasher you have There's also custom units that you can program how they flash, if you can't find them for a car, look for them under motorcycles.
